InstaSpot Company offers its clients a unique service - opening of segregated accounts which provides protection of the client’s capital from risks of any force majeure circumstances related to the company’s activity. In accepted sense of the term "the segregated account" means storage of clients’ funds separately from funds of the company.

InstaSpot Company has developed a new standard of safety guarantee for client’s funds establishing the segregated accounts by the following principle:
The owner of a segregated trading account with InstaSpot Company can store 70% from his/her deposit on bank account or on the account of an authorized representative. So, he/she is able to make operations with the full deposited sum while the safe margin is enough.

Example: The client wants to have a segregated account with InstaSpot Company with the balance of $150,000. When the account is opened, the client orders service of segregated account and sends all the requested documents. After the service is confirmed by the company, the client needs to fulfill two conditions to receive $150,000 to the account:

  • to transfer 30%, that is $45,000 for its replenishment;
  • to send bank statements confirming the amount available on his/her bank account which equals $105,000.

Right after all given conditions are fulfilled, the client receives the trading account with $150,000 on it, and 70% of this sum is stored on his/her personal bank account, i. e. is protected from any force majeur risks of the company's activity.

The system of segregated accounts by InstaSpot Company provides full protection to its clients and guarantees funds safety which is as high as on your bank’s account.

The minimum sum of deposit for segregated account is $50,000.00.

For registration of segregated account service, it is necessary to print out and fill S-1 form and send it to segregated-accounts@instaforex.com.
